Whitechapel Station might not boast a ticket office, but ticket machines are available for convenience. Travellers can easily collect their tickets from these machines although they might not be accessible for everyone as the station still lacks accessible ticket machines. Step-free access throughout the station ensures that individuals with mobility issues can comfortably navigate the premises. However, it's worth noting that although Wi-Fi and payphones are unavailable, smartcard validators and induction loops are in place for added convenience.
For those in need of information or assistance, help points are strategically located within the station. Enthusiasts travelling on national rail services can request assistance through the Passenger Assist service, a thoughtful provision for those requiring extra support. Although seating areas are available, Whitechapel unfortunately does not offer waiting rooms, refreshment facilities, or bicycle storage. Nevertheless, there are baby changing facilities, a thoughtful addition for those travelling with infants.
While the station does not provide a dedicated car park or cycle hire facilities, the presence of a rail replacement bus stop creates a seamless connection for journey continuation should train services be disrupted. Passengers can easily access this service at a local bus stop near the station entrance on Station Road. The station is equipped with a range of amenities designed for comfort and convenience. The ticket office has generous hours, remaining open from 5:45 AM to 8:15 PM on weekdays, ensuring you can purchase or collect tickets at ease. There are ticket machines available, with accessible options to cater to all needs. Smartcard holders can rejoice as there are card validators stationed throughout.
Banbury Station prides itself on being highly accessible, with step-free access throughout and lifts connecting all platforms. However, note that while there are accessible ticket machines and ramps for train access, accessible toilets are currently unavailable. For those in need of assistance, staff are available every day from early morning until late at night, and help points are conveniently spread throughout the premises.
Getting to and from Banbury Station is a breeze, thanks to its excellent connectivity with other transport modes. If you're facing a rail replacement situation, buses are conveniently located at the front of the station. Need a cab? You can easily find taxis waiting outside as well.
